Transaction 3e40c4422729c5fa4154abbe3b7a681568ea16037aa760f60aed58f7bd807d52
1 Input
1 Output
-
3e40c4422729c5fa4154abbe3b7a681568ea16037aa760f60aed58f7bd807d52:0
- value
- 99982561
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5cdb867e9d363df1d25f4c642b746a74f99764f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HaHkRQbkQwAEUZzhzs4uhrjyamJinDL2m